Guidance From A Probate Lawyer In Estate Matters
A probate lawyer helps manage the distribution of a deceased person’s assets, ensuring the legal process—called probate—is handled properly. Probate can be tricky, especially when emotions run high and family members disagree. These lawyers step in to interpret wills, settle debts, and transfer property according to state laws and the deceased’s wishes.
Without a probate lawyer, the court process can feel like a maze. Deadlines, paperwork, and legal jargon make things overwhelming for families already dealing with loss. These attorneys simplify the chaos. They ensure the estate is settled fairly, reducing the chance of costly mistakes or family disputes. Whether someone dies with or without a will, a probate lawyer knows how to manage the process smoothly.
Support From A TN Visa Immigration Lawyer For Cross-Border Professionals
A TN Visa Immigration lawyer specializes in helping qualified professionals from Canada and Mexico work legally in the United States under the TN visa, which was created through NAFTA (now USMCA). This visa allows citizens of these two countries to enter the U.S. temporarily for professional jobs in fields like science, engineering, medicine, and education.
TN visa applications involve more than just paperwork. A skilled TN Visa Immigration lawyer ensures eligibility requirements are met, helps craft employer letters, and prepares clients for questions at the border or consulate. TN status must be renewed periodically, and mistakes can lead to delays or denials. With the stakes so high—especially for careers and families—having a lawyer with this focus is essential.

Helping Families Heal With Compassionate Probate Services
Death brings grief, but also responsibility. A probate lawyer acts as a steady guide for families trying to honor a loved one’s memory while fulfilling legal duties. Beyond court filings, they help with tasks like selling property, transferring bank accounts, and locating beneficiaries.
This legal support helps avoid tension during an already difficult time. Instead of fighting over who gets what, families can focus on healing. Skilled probate lawyers also mediate disagreements and offer solutions when no clear instructions exist. Their involvement can preserve relationships and protect everyone’s rights.
